Philip’s nice Sony NEX FS700 review
Philip Bloom had a hands on with the much anticipated Sony FS700. The $7999 camera that will give you 240fps slow motion and sports a 4K sensor.
Watch the two videos and give him credit because this review is pretty nice to watch. There is a writeup on his website as well.
